Built in 1968, this 3,600 horsepower General Motors F45
hauled transcontinental fast freights
After 33 years of service – and 7 years of catching rain – it was saved from the scrapper’s torch
In 2008-9 it was painstakingly restored by skilled craftsmen at
RELCO Locomotives, Albia, Iowa
It was the first locomotive in 40 years to be painted in
Great Northern’s stunning “Big Sky Blue”
In August 2009, BNSF Railway hauled GN 441 1,746 miles from Iowa to Montana
Sweetgrass Hills west of Etheridge, Montana
Massive sideboom bulldozers were needed to lift 441 onto its track

The Izaak Walton Inn is a historic hotel at Essex, Montana, on the south border of Glacier National Park. It was built for the Great Northern Railway in 1939 to host tourists and fishermen in the summer and railroad workers in the winter. It is the only Glacier Park resort that is open year-round.
